Jim,
This web page might be useful to you:
http://www.sucarb.co.uk/ExplodedImageClassic.aspx?ProductId=10898

AUD 328 (F and R) is listed as the carbs for USA spec MKlll 1275 Midgets
from 1968 to 1969

I'm trying to get my 60 BE project going before the nice weather hits. I got
the engine back from the shop and bought a set of carbs from E-bay over the
winter. the 1275 has been bored to 1300 and the ID # 12C/DA/H29827 id's as a
1970 High Compression Healey engine.  The carbs are HS2's with the Y pipe
and
Im not sure of their heritage. The numbers on them are AUD 328 F and AUD 328
R
 I assume Front and rear? Can these be identified?. I need the link that
joins the carb linkage together. I have a pair of original 948 SU's and as
usual Frank was right and it looks like a different setup.


Thanks J.
